Address

NRcGfF4vQ92iFuTKDXSmmtedmnKhSMCq53

0 XNA

Confirmed
Total Received245.98689735 XNA
Total Sent245.98689735 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NRcGfF4vQ92iFuTKDXSmmtedmnKhSMCq53245.98689735 XNA
 
 
NRcGfF4vQ92iFuTKDXSmmtedmnKhSMCq53245.98689735 XNA